The Exercise–Skin Connection: More Than Just a Glow

Every time you work out, your body undergoes remarkable physical changes that deeply benefit your skin. This happens through the coordinated functioning of two important glands:

✔ Sweat Glands

Help your body detox naturally by flushing out impurities, bacteria, and dirt from the skin surface.

✔ Sebaceous (Oil) Glands

Maintain skin moisture—but can cause acne when they overproduce oil. Exercise helps keep them balanced.

 

💪 How Exercise Boosts Your Skin Health

1. Improved Blood Circulation = A Natural Glow

When you exercise, your heart works harder, increasing blood flow to your skin. This:

  • Delivers oxygen and nutrients to skin cells
  • Boosts collagen production
  • Repairs damaged skin faster
  • Gives the popular post-workout glow
  • Promotes younger, firmer, brighter skin

 

2. Reduces Stress & Controls Hormone Imbalance

High stress increases cortisol, which can:

  • Cause acne flare-ups
  • Trigger oil overproduction
  • Aggravate eczema and psoriasis
  • Speed up skin aging
  • Exercise lowers cortisol naturally and releases endorphins, making your skin calmer, clearer, and less inflamed.

 

3. Exercise Helps Control PCOD-Related Skin Problems

PCOD/PCOS often shows up as:

  • Stubborn jawline acne
  • Oily skin
  • Excess facial hair
  • Dark patches around neck & underarms
  • Irregular periods
  • Regular exercise improves:
  • Insulin sensitivity
  • Hormonal balance (especially androgens)
  • Menstrual regularity
  • Overall inflammation

Studies show that 30 minutes of exercise, 5 times a week significantly reduces PCOD symptoms and improves skin health.

 

4. Natural Detoxification Through Sweating

Sweating during exercise helps your skin remove:

  • Toxins
  • Dirt trapped in pores
  • Excess salts
  • Environmental pollutants

This prevents clogged pores and reduces acne—as long as you cleanse afterward.

 

5. Exercise Helps Clear Acne

Contrary to popular belief, sweating does NOT cause acne. When combined with good hygiene, exercise actually helps reduce breakouts by:

  • Lowering inflammation
  • Balancing oil production
  • Clearing dead skin cells through sweat
  • Reducing stress-triggered acne

 

6. Anti-Aging Benefits

Exercise is one of the most effective non-medical anti-aging therapies:

  • Boosts elastin & collagen
  • Tightens skin
  • Reduces fine lines
  • Improves skin firmness
  • Enhances cellular regeneration
  • Regular activity keeps skin youthful and radiant for years.

 

🏃 Best Exercises for Healthy, Glowing Skin

✔ Cardio (Running, Cycling, Swimming, Skipping)

Increases heart rate → enhances circulation → improves oxygen supply.

✔ Yoga & Pranayama

Excellent for stress reduction and hormonal balance.

✔ Strength Training

Regulates metabolism and improves insulin sensitivity (great for PCOD).

✔ Facial Yoga

Improves facial muscle tone and reduces early signs of aging.

 

 

🧴 Essential Post-Workout Skin Care Tips

A good routine after exercise prevents breakouts and irritation:

  • Cleanse within 30 minutes
  • Use mild, pH-balanced cleansers
  • Shower in lukewarm water
  • Moisturize to restore hydration
  • Use breathable, sweat-wicking clothes
  • Remove makeup before workouts
  • Pat sweat gently—don’t rub
  • Stay hydrated before & after exercise
